See the + * GNU Lesser General Public License for more details. + * + * You should have received a copy of the GNU Lesser General Public + * License along with this program; if not, write to the Free Software + * Foundation, Inc., 675 Mass Ave, Cambridge, MA 02139, USA. + * + * $Id: g726.h,v 1.26 2009/04/12 09:12:10 steveu Exp $ + */ + +/*! \file */ + +#if !defined(_SPANDSP_G726_H_) +#define _SPANDSP_G726_H_ + +/*! \page g726_page G.726 encoding and decoding +\section g726_page_sec_1 What does it do? + +The G.726 module is a bit exact implementation of the full ITU G.726 specification. +It supports: + - 16 kbps, 24kbps, 32kbps, and 40kbps operation. + - Tandem adjustment, for interworking with A-law and u-law. + - Annex A support, for use in environments not using A-law or u-law. + +It passes the ITU tests. + +\section g726_page_sec_2 How does it work? +???. +*/ + +enum +{ + G726_ENCODING_LINEAR = 0, /* Interworking with 16 bit signed linear */ + G726_ENCODING_ULAW, /* Interworking with u-law */ + G726_ENCODING_ALAW /* Interworking with A-law */ +}; + +enum +{ + G726_PACKING_NONE = 0, + G726_PACKING_LEFT = 1, + G726_PACKING_RIGHT = 2 +}; + +/*! + G.726 state + */ +typedef struct g726_state_s g726_state_t; + +typedef int16_t (*g726_decoder_func_t)(g726_state_t *s, uint8_t code); + +typedef uint8_t (*g726_encoder_func_t)(g726_state_t *s, int16_t amp); + +#if defined(__cplusplus) +extern "C" +{ +#endif + +/*! Initialise a G.726 encode or decode context. + \param s The G.726 context. + \param bit_rate The required bit rate for the ADPCM data. + The valid rates are 16000, 24000, 32000 and 40000. + \param ext_coding The coding used outside G.726. + \param packing One of the G.726_PACKING_xxx options. + \return A pointer to the G.726 context, or NULL for error. */ +SPAN_DECLARE(g726_state_t *) g726_init(g726_state_t *s, int bit_rate, int ext_coding, int packing); + +/*! Release a G.726 encode or decode context. + \param s The G.726 context. + \return 0 for OK. */ +SPAN_DECLARE(int) g726_release(g726_state_t *s); + +/*! Free a G.726 encode or decode context. + \param s The G.726 context. + \return 0 for OK. */ +SPAN_DECLARE(int) g726_free(g726_state_t *s); + +/*! Decode a buffer of G.726 ADPCM data to linear PCM, a-law or u-law. + \param s The G.726 context. + \param amp The audio sample buffer. + \param g726_data + \param g726_bytes + \return The number of samples returned. */ +SPAN_DECLARE(int) g726_decode(g726_state_t *s, + int16_t amp[], + const uint8_t g726_data[], + int g726_bytes); + +/*! Encode a buffer of linear PCM data to G.726 ADPCM. + \param s The G.726 context. + \param g726_data The G.726 data produced. + \param amp The audio sample buffer. + \param len The number of samples in the buffer. + \return The number of bytes of G.726 data produced. */ +SPAN_DECLARE(int) g726_encode(g726_state_t *s, + uint8_t g726_data[], + const int16_t amp[], + int len); + +#if defined(__cplusplus) +} +#endif + +#endif +/*- End of file ------------------------------------------------------------*/
